Hacks for Managing and Reducing Digital Distractions

In today's digital age, it's easy to become overwhelmed by constant notifications, social media updates, and endless streams of information. However, by implementing a few hacks, you can regain control of your digital life and reduce distractions. Here are some effective strategies to manage and minimize digital distractions.

First and foremost, take control of your notifications. Review the settings on your devices and applications and disable unnecessary notifications. Prioritize the essential ones and limit them to what truly requires your immediate attention. By reducing the number of notifications, you can create a calmer and more focused digital environment.

Designate specific times for checking and responding to emails and messages. Constantly interrupting your workflow to attend to incoming messages can disrupt your concentration. Instead, allocate specific blocks of time throughout the day to address your digital communications, allowing you to maintain better focus on your tasks.

Utilize productivity apps and browser extensions that help manage distractions. These tools can block certain websites or apps during specific times or limit your time spent on them. By setting boundaries and creating a digital environment conducive to productivity, you can significantly reduce distractions and enhance your focus.

Practice mindful browsing and be intentional with your online activities. Before diving into a digital rabbit hole, ask yourself if it aligns with your current goals or priorities. Develop self-awareness and recognize when you're mindlessly scrolling or engaging in unproductive online behavior. Redirect your attention to more meaningful activities or tasks.

 

Create digital-free zones or time periods. Designate certain spaces or specific hours during the day where you intentionally disconnect from technology. This could be during meals, family time, or before bedtime. By establishing these boundaries, you create opportunities for genuine connection, relaxation, and rejuvenation away from the digital world.

Implement the Pomodoro Technique or similar time-management strategies. This method involves working in focused intervals, typically 25 minutes, followed by short breaks. During the work interval, eliminate distractions and fully commit to the task at hand. The regular breaks provide opportunities to recharge and minimize mental fatigue.

Finally, develop a mindful and healthy relationship with social media. Limit your time spent on social platforms by setting specific time limits or using apps that track and manage your usage. Curate your social media feeds to include content that adds value and positivity to your life, and unfollow accounts that contribute to distractions or negativity.

By implementing these hacks, you can regain control over your digital life and reduce distractions. Remember, managing digital distractions is a continuous practice that requires discipline and intention. With mindful choices and effective strategies, you can create a healthier and more focused digital environment that supports your overall well-being and productivity.
